    Quote Originally Posted by arkansasbowhunter View Post
    I put the rod off the front (push)instead of back (pull) u push forward and pull from behind. U need to add wt on the push rod to get the bait down deep fast unlike out the back of the boat. Couldnt imagine running 100 feet line off the front pole as it would go under the boat and get in the motor possibly.
    I even push off the back when the fish are deeper than you can get a Bandit down to. I was catching them at 25ft. one day and with 150ft. of line out I could not get the bait deep enough. I added 3oz. weight to the line a short 2ft. leader and dropped the weight down to the depth I needed it and pushed off the back of the boat!Here's 1 pic of a 13" fish that was caught that way!
